Email Paste Shortcut
Overview
Paste the primary Chrome profile email into the focused field with a hotkey.
Email Paste Shortcut helps you quickly insert your signed-in Chrome profile email address into any text field, without typing it manually. How it works: • Press Cmd+Shift+U (Mac) or Ctrl+Shift+U (Windows/Linux) to paste your Chrome profile email. • Works in most input fields, textareas, and contenteditable areas. • Automatically ignores incognito windows and situations where no profile is signed in. • If the field can’t be edited, your email is copied to the clipboard instead. Perfect for: • Quickly logging into services with your Chrome account email. • Filling forms with your primary email in one step. Privacy First: • Your email is retrieved from Chrome’s built-in profile data. • No data is stored, transmitted, or shared — everything happens locally in your browser.
